Suction dredging systems utilize suction pumps to remove the bottom sediments and decomposed organic matter. This method is less invasive, preserving the aquatic life and the natural pond environment. It uses a ‘vacuum-like’ process to suck up and filter the bottom sediments, working more like a vacuum cleaner. Hydraulic dredging is a more environment-friendly alternative. Although effective, mechanical dredging can cause significant damage to the shoreline and overall pond ecosystem. This process often requires pond drainage and the relocation or termination of aquatic life. Mechanical dredging involves using heavy equipment to remove muck, weeds, sediment, and other harmful materials from ponds. Let’s look at a few commonly used methods and their implications. Sediments, silt, and other materials can fill up the bottom of the pond, blocking sunlight, reducing oxygen levels and eventually leading to the death of aquatic life. Without regular dredging, your pond can easily become an unhealthy ecosystem. It prevents excessive weed growth and maintains the required water and oxygen levels. The Need for Dredgingĭredging, a process of removing accumulated sediments and other debris from the bottom of a pond, is an effective solution to keep your pond clean and safe. Therefore, maintaining the health and cleanliness of a pond becomes crucial. The diverse species, ranging from migrating birds to larger land animals like deer, find ponds an essential part of their ecosystem. However, ponds can offer a healthy and beneficial ecosystem for wildlife to thrive if maintained properly. Such matter settles at the bottom of the pond, reducing water and oxygen levels, which are vital for plant and animal life. They are considered “dying ecosystems” from the moment they are created due to the accumulation of organic matter like dead leaves, dirt, and debris. Ponds, by their nature, are small and stagnant bodies of water.
